This research group is involved in several projects that seek to identify how markets, policies and practices related to climate change affect small-scale and community based forestry initiatives. Research products will inform both community practitioners and policymakers seeking inclusive and equitable ways to engage communities and family forests in advancing their socioecological goals and addressing climate change.
